Allusion: A reference made to a well-known person, event, or idea in order to make a comparison or convey a deeper meaning without explicitly stating it.
Figurative Language: Language that uses figures of speech or literary devices to create a deeper or more imaginative meaning, rather than literal language.
Connotations: The emotional or cultural associations that a word carries beyond its literal meaning, which can impact the way the word is perceived.
